1. A programmable display switch apparatus, comprising:

  • a power supply that provides power to the programmable display switch;

    a programming port that allows customizing one or more applications to which the programmable display switch is applied;

    one or more latching relays for controlling an attached circuit,a control logic circuit that changes a relay state of the one or more latching relays based on a programmed application of the programmable display switch;

    a display control and switch sensor circuit that stores a customized on state image and a customized off state image related to the programmed application of the programmable display switch and that commands the control logic circuit to change the relay state of the relays based on user input;

    a programmable display that;

    1) is programmable to display either the on state image or the off state image based on a current state of the programmable display switch,2) while not being touched, displays one of the images that represents the current state of the programmable display switch, and3) once touched, detects the touch and causes the displayed one of the images to change to another of the images associated with an opposite state,whereby the programmable display switch can be applied in a variety of installations with images shown on the programmable display and operation of the relays customized for the specific application of the programmable display switch.
